Latest Patents

Riedel's latest patents focus on a method for manufacturing a microelectronic circuit. This invention involves providing a substrate and producing source, bulk, and drain contacts for both a transistor and a memory transistor. In a common step, insulating layers and metal layers for both types of transistors are created. Additionally, at least one capacitor is produced as part of the memory transistor. The invention also includes the production of gate contacts that connect to the metal layers of both the transistor and the capacitor of the memory transistor.
